Senior Electrical Engineer
Designs, evaluates, and optimizes electrical systems for BYD flash-charging infrastructure, ensuring safe, compliant, and reliable deployment across Indonesia.
Job Summary
The Senior Electrical Engineer is responsible for the design, evaluation, implementation, and optimization of electrical systems supporting BYD's flash charging infrastructure. This role ensures charging facilities are designed and operated in accordance with technical standards, safety regulations, and project requirements while supporting the expansion of BYD's EV charging network across Indonesia.
Job Descriptions
Design and review electrical systems for EV charging infrastructure projects, including power distribution, protection systems, and equipment specifications.
Conduct site assessments, electrical load calculations, feasibility studies, and technical evaluations for charging station deployment.
Prepare and review electrical drawings, single-line diagrams, technical specifications, and engineering documentation.
Coordinate with utility providers, contractors, consultants, and government authorities regarding electrical requirements and approvals.
Support installation, testing, commissioning, and troubleshooting activities for charging facilities.
Ensure compliance with electrical standards, safety regulations, and company engineering requirements.
Analyze operational performance and reliability of charging stations, identifying opportunities for improvement and optimization.
Collaborate with project, operations, and business development teams to support successful charging infrastructure expansion.
Job Requirements
Bachelor's Degree in Electrical Engineering or a related field.
Minimum 5 years of experience in electrical engineering, power systems, EV charging infrastructure, utilities, renewable energy, or industrial projects.
Strong knowledge of power distribution systems, transformers, switchgear, protection systems, and electrical design principles.
Experience with EV charging technology, high-voltage systems, and electrical infrastructure projects is preferred.
Proficiency in electrical design software such as AutoCAD, ETAP, DIgSILENT, or similar engineering tools.
Familiarity with Indonesian electrical standards, regulations, and utility connection processes.
Strong analytical, troubleshooting, and problem-solving skills.
Fluent in Bahasa Indonesia and English; Mandarin proficiency is an advantage.
